Convict name: Denver, William.

sentence_details:
Convicted at Isle of Man Gaol Delivery for a term of life on 07 August 1821

vessel: Shipley

date_of_departure: November 1821.

place_of_arrival: New South Wales.

source:
Microfilm Roll 88, Class and Piece Number HO11/4, Page Number 110

title:
William Denver, one of 150 convicts transported on the Shipley, November 1821.
